Soda, Stream likewise suggests that you only offer cold water for carbonation instead of space temperature level or warm water. Cold, pure water is the perfect channel to get carbonation considering that it has a high saturation limit and CO2 gas doesn't escape extremely easily.
After placing the water bottle into its designated nozzle, the majority of soda makers need you to just press a button and the maker does the rest. Some machines have preset timers to enable ideal carbonation each time while others enable more modification, needing you to hold the button down till you are pleased.
This standard process is what every soda maker design follows regardless of its advancements or other settings. So what makes the One Touch various from the Fizzi? Both placing the carbonating cylinder and the water bottle require that you follow the precise very same procedure just like the Fizzi, and this maker also just takes 1 L-sized bottles. The One Touch requires electrical energy to run since it boasts 3 buttons, each predetermined for different levels of carbonation.
The 2nd setting is the average 10-second burst that a lot of individuals will stick to typically. It provides a carbonated drink practically identical to the one produced by the Fizzi or other soda makers. The third and final button provides a higher level of carbonation by firing for about 15 seconds prior to stopping.
Basically, the One Touch offers greater pre-programmed levels of soda customization for a slightly greater asking price. Of course, you'll have to decide if the absence of modification in between those levels is worth it to you. You can also acquire it in black or white colors and it looks practically similar to the Fizzi; the just significant difference is the power cord that runs out the back.
This being stated, the power draw from this device is extremely light. You might easily still take this soda maker outdoor camping and run it with a portable generator or a Recreational Vehicle's battery without issue. It's not most likely to short out your outlets or cause your kitchen any issues. The only drawback is the relative thinness of the power cable television.

Straight above the slot where your water bottle will go is a series of three water droplet icons. These icons indicate the existing level of carbonation you are instilling into your water bottle based on your pressure and the time you have actually held the button down.
s are valuable due to the fact that it can be difficult to tell how much carbonation you confused into your water bottle with the other models that utilize the very same button system. Say that you forgot the length of time you held the button down; now you have to sip the water bottle yourself to determine how bubbly it is prior to you can continue or cease carbonation.

Soda, Stream machines work best when you carbonate routine water that hasn't yet blended with flavorings or other ingredients. It's easier to carbonate the water efficiently this way. When you're ended up carbonating your water, you can add pieces of fruit to instill some light flavor or mix the carbonated water with a little however focused quantity of another beverage.
These syrups are concentrated formulas that supply typical or reasonably unique flavorings for your carbonated water bottles. Obviously, the appeal of the syrups is that you can add however much or little you want. Like with the carbonating buttons, Soda, Stream's genuine magic originates from the ability to tailor your soft drink exactly the method you like it.
